Pigmented Rings With Central Clearing: A Dermoscopic Feature of Melasma

Summary
Diagnosing melasma can be difficult. This study introduces pigmented rings with central clearing (PRCC) as a new dermoscopic feature to help identify melasma and differentiate it from other skin conditions.
Area of Science:
- Dermatology
- Dermatopathology
- Medical Diagnostics
Background:
- Melasma is a common facial pigmentary disorder.
- Accurate diagnosis of melasma is challenging due to its varied appearance and overlap with other conditions.
- Dermoscopy is a valuable tool for in vivo skin lesion examination.
Purpose of the Study:
- To introduce a novel dermoscopic feature: pigmented rings with central clearing (PRCC).
- To evaluate the diagnostic utility of PRCC in melasma.
- To assess the ability of PRCC to differentiate melasma from other facial pigmentary disorders.
Main Methods:
- Dermoscopic images of melasma and similar conditions were analyzed.
- The presence and characteristics of PRCC were documented.
- Statistical analysis was performed to determine the significance of PRCC in diagnosing melasma.
Main Results:
- The study identified pigmented rings with central clearing (PRCC) as a distinct dermoscopic finding.
- PRCC was observed in a significant proportion of melasma cases.
- PRCC demonstrated potential in distinguishing melasma from other facial pigmentary disorders.
Conclusions:
- Pigmented rings with central clearing (PRCC) represent a novel and potentially useful dermoscopic feature for melasma diagnosis.
- This finding may improve the accuracy and efficiency of differentiating melasma from other facial dermatoses.
- Further research is warranted to validate PRCC in larger, diverse populations.

The color of the skin is influenced by a number of pigments, including melanin, carotene, and hemoglobin. Recall that melanin is produced by cells called melanocytes, which are found scattered throughout the stratum basale of the epidermis. The melanin is transferred to the keratinocytes via melanosomes.
